| This field excursion to the central Oregon High Cascades highlights aspects of the Ouaternary volcanic and glacial history in the vicinity of Mount Bachelor (formerly Bachelor Butte), South Sister, and Bend. The guidebook includes a roadlog that contains brief descriptions of the stops interspersed with papers that discuss some of the key features and interpretations of the stops. Each day's stops are numbered beginning with 1 and are referred to by day and stop number (for example Day 2-Stop 4). Figures and tables are numbered consecutively from the introduction through the last contribution; references from all sections are combined at the end of the guidebook. Each day's log begins at Little Fawn Campground, a group campground run by the U.S. Forest Service on the south end of Elk Lake. -- Scott, et.al., 1989 |
